Everything You Need To Know About Gallstone Surgery

Gallstone surgery is a common surgical procedure that is used to remove gallstones from the gallbladder. Gallstones are small, hard deposits that form in the gallbladder. They can range in size from a grain of sand to a golf ball. Gallstone surgery is usually recommended when someone has symptoms caused by gallstones, such as pain in the upper right abdomen, nausea, and vomiting.
